Role Summary/Purpose:

The Senior Counsel, Global Investigations will be part of a team leading government, regulatory and significant internal investigations for GE Vernova. The role will be part of the new GE Vernova Global Law & Policy Headquarters team and work with functional and business colleagues with a particular focus on work in Asia. This role will report to the Chief Counsel, Global Investigations for GE Vernova.

Essential Responsibilities:

  • Supporting management of governmental / regulatory investigations and internal investigations globally (with a focus on Asia) that could raise legal or reputational risk for GE Vernova and/or its businesses
  • Working on matters that may require appearance in front of enforcement agencies
  • Ability to co-manage complex investigations across different legal risk areas and different countries
  • Driving measurable efficiencies in investigative matter management, including with regard to budgets for external counsel and forensic/discovery-related needs
  • Helping to spot (i) emerging issues and trends, (ii) define process improvements and (iii) help with training initiatives

Qualifications / Requirements:

  • J.D. or equivalent law degree from a recognized international institution
  • Significant governmental investigative experience in the public sector or equivalent white-collar defense work experience in the private sector
  • Strong investigative experience in a common law and/or civil law jurisdiction and exposure to working in diverse, complex markets
  • Strong working knowledge of regulatory and compliance laws in particular in Asia
  • Investigative experience in one or more of the following areas: Anti-corruption laws in the United States and internationally, Trade controls/sanctioned country law, Anti-trust law, Anti-money laundering law, Intellectual property theft / economic espionage / computer crimes, Complex frauds
  • Mandarin language proficiency preferred
  • High level of cultural sensitivity, flexibility and emotional intelligence in order to work effectively within GE Vernova's multicultural environment and with local GE teams

Desired Characteristics:

  • Demonstrated ability to analyze facts and data and draw reasonable conclusions, communicate clearly, possess excellent writing skills and as a strong team player be able to work effectively with others at various levels of the organization
  • As the position requires working across various functions within GE Vernova (e.g., Legal & Compliance, Security, HR, Finance), demonstrated networking skills
  • Flexible and collaborative team player who is passionate about GE Vernova's mission
  • Ability to work independently in an evolving, fast-paced environment and manage multiple projects while maintaining a high quality of work
  • Experience in and understanding of the energy / power generation sector and products
